The Evolution of Casual Gaming: From Desktop to Digital Ecosystems

Historically, casual games such as Bejeweled (2001) or Angry Birds (2009) served as accessible entertainment for broad audiences. They thrived on intuitive mechanics and garnered virality through social sharing. Today, the landscape has shifted further toward browser-based and mobile-friendly platforms that eliminate barriers to entry. This evolution is characterized by a move away from complex, high-commitment titles to quick-play options that encourage repeated engagement without the need for downloads or updates.

The Significance of ‘Drop-and-Play’ Mechanics in Digital Gaming

Drop-and-play mechanics refer to games that can be accessed with minimal setup or registration, often via web browsers, and are designed for short, engaging sessions. This approach aligns with current digital consumption patterns driven by mobile usage, social media integration, and instant connectivity. Notable industry examples include browser-based puzzle games, mini-games embedded within social platforms, and quick-match multiplayer experiences.

Data underscores the potency of this genre: a 2023 report from Game Analytics Weekly indicates that casual browser games accounted for over 40% of daily active users on social gaming platforms, with many titles experiencing high virality and sharing rates. This underscores the importance of seamless access and immediacy in fostering user retention and word-of-mouth growth.
